Output ef364d6b0dcb70a54f6129f037ee9eca1e9617ea5da26e70317bfd2e9eb3751f:21

value
369005
script pubkey
OP_0 OP_PUSHBYTES_32 0eb83d3a63e9ea0981f1c0c4396087ce6e4b1b35487334a6481c505da244aa1c
address
bc1qp6ur6wnra84qnq03crzrjcy8eehykxe4fpenffjgr3g9mgjy4gwqp5xlam
transaction
ef364d6b0dcb70a54f6129f037ee9eca1e9617ea5da26e70317bfd2e9eb3751f